Why Choose a Robotic Hoover?
Before diving into particular designs, it's crucial to comprehend the advantages of robotic hoovers:
- Time-Saving: Robotic hoovers can operate autonomously, allowing users to designate their time to other essential tasks.
- Smart Technology: Many models feature sophisticated features such as app control, scheduling, and even integration with virtual assistants like Amazon Alexa or Google Assistant.
- Effective Cleaning: Equipped with numerous sensing units and brushes, robotic vacuums can clean up various floor types, including carpets and hardwood.
- Compact Design: These vacuums can navigate under furniture and in tight areas, recording dust and debris that conventional designs might miss.

1. iRobot Roomba i7+
The iRobot Roomba i7+ is a leading performer and is typically considered the very best robotic vacuum on the market. Among its most impressive functions is the self-emptying base, which allows users to forget about vacuuming for weeks at a time. With clever mapping abilities, i7+ learns the design of your home and adapts its cleansing routes accordingly.
2. Roborock S7
Including an unique mopping function, the Roborock S7 integrates powerful suction with the ability to scrub floorings. This makes it a versatile option for those who want an extensive clean. Its innovative navigation system ensures it prevents barriers and effectively covers your home, making it a strong contender at a mid-range rate.
3. Eufy RoboVac G30 Edge
For those on a spending plan, the Eufy RoboVac G30 Edge provides excellent worth without compromising efficiency. It operates silently, making it an ideal choice for homes with animals or young kids. Though it does not have some advanced functions, it efficiently cleans up both carpets and difficult floors.
4. Neato Botvac D8
The Neato Botvac D8's distinct D-shape style allows it to tidy corners better than its circular equivalents. It features a high-performance HEPA filter, making it an excellent choice for allergic reaction sufferers. With laser navigation, it effectively maps your space for optimum cleaning.
5. Shark IQ Robot
The Shark IQ Robot is understood for its self-emptying capability and reliable scrubbing brush. Users appreciate its capability to manage animal hair and numerous flooring types. It's a solid alternative for families searching for a reputable cleaner at a reasonable price.
6. Ecovacs Deebot T8 AIVI
Ecovacs' Deebot T8 AIVI boasts innovative technology with object acknowledgment, enabling it to prevent challenges successfully. With a long battery life and dual cleansing capabilities (vacuuming and mopping), it stands out in the congested market of robotic hoovers.
Features to Consider When Buying a Robotic Hoover
When picking a robotic vacuum cleaner, think about the following features:
- Suction Power: Look for models with adjustable suction settings for various floor types.
- Battery Life: Longer battery life makes sure that the vacuum can clean up larger areas without needing to charge.
- Mapping and Navigation: Advanced navigation systems enhance cleaning effectiveness and avoid the vacuum from getting stuck.
- Self-Emptying Base: This feature substantially lowers maintenance and inconvenience.
- App Integration: Many modern-day robotic vacuums included smart device apps for controlling the device remotely.
- Rate: Set a budget and compare models within that variety to find the finest value for your needs.
Frequently Asked Question About Robotic Hoovers
1. Do robotic vacuums work on carpets?
Yes, most robotic vacuums are created to work effectively on carpets in addition to tough floors. Models like the iRobot Roomba i7+ and Roborock S7 have effective suction that can deep clean carpets.
2. How frequently should I run my robotic vacuum?
It depends upon your family's needs. For families with family pets or heavy foot traffic, running the vacuum daily might be advantageous. Others might find that a couple of times a week suffices.
3. Can robotic vacuums browse stairs?
Robotic vacuums are designed not to drop stairs; they typically use cliff sensing units to detect edges. Nevertheless, they can not clean up stairs as they are designed for flat surfaces.

Most robotic hoovers operate at a lower noise level compared to conventional vacuums. Nevertheless, noise levels can differ between models, so it's excellent to check the spec if sound is an issue.
5. Do I need to empty the bin after every usage?
Not always-- some models come with self-emptying bases that lessen the frequency of bin emptying. Others will need manual emptying after every couple of uses, depending on the quantity of dirt collected.
